- The casting, disclosed Monday ahead of the Cannes film market, introduces the project to buyers through Fortitude International.
- Vincent Cassel co-stars as a retired Belgian police detective who enters the case in a nod to Hercule Poirot.
- Bertie Ellwood directs from Ernesto Foronda’s script, adapted from Jared Cade’s book on Christie’s 1926 disappearance.
- The film is in pre-production with plans to shoot in the U.K. this summer, with Range Media Partners handling U.S. rights and Fortitude leading international sales.
